Meiofauna is one of the fundamental components of benthic communities and is characterized by high abundance and diversity, fast turnover rates and occupies a key position in the food web. Meiofauna contains most known animal phyla and is certainly the most abundant and diversified group in the world.
 
MeioScool's objective is to bring together several meiofaunal experts in Brest in order to:

1) Increase awareness of researchers, students and general public to the fundamental role of meiofauna in marine ecosystems from the coastal zone to abyssal depths.

2) Train students and researchers to the identification and description of meiofauna through several complementary disciplines (taxonomy, ecology, molecular biology) and stimulate a new generation of meiobenthologists.
 
The MeioScool workshop will last 4 days. The first two days will be devoted to conferences while the two other days will be devoted to field and laboratory work (sampling, extraction, identification of major meiofaunal taxonomic groups).
